Emerson 5X00105G14 core controller board card
Communication and interface characteristics
System communication
Support the Ovation system’s exclusive high-speed communication Protocol (such as Redundancy Protocol) to achieve seamless switching between the primary and backup controllers. The communication rate can reach over 100Mbps, ensuring the real-time performance and reliability of data transmission.
Compatible with industrial standard protocols such as Modbus and EtherNet/IP, it can be connected to third-party devices (such as PLC and HMI).
Expansion interface: It is equipped with multiple high-speed serial interfaces (such as RS-485, RS-232) and Ethernet interfaces, and supports connection with input/output modules (I/O Module), remote I/O stations and the upper computer monitoring system.
Data processing and control functions
Input/Output (I/O) processing:
It can manage hundreds of analog quantity (such as 4-20mA, 0-10V) and switch quantity (DI/DO) data, with a sampling rate of ≤1ms, ensuring a rapid response to industrial field signals.
Supports high-precision A/D and D/A conversion, with a resolution typically of 16 bits or higher (such as analog input accuracy ±0.05% FS).
Reliability and environmental adaptability
Redundant design: Supports hot standby redundancy (Redundant Configuration). When the main controller fails, the standby controller can automatically take over, with a switching time of ≤50ms, ensuring the continuous operation of the system.
Working environment
Temperature range: -40℃ to +70℃ (industrial grade), suitable for harsh industrial scenarios such as high and low temperatures.
Humidity range: 5% – 95%. No condensation. Strong anti-vibration (if in compliance with ISO 16750 standard) and anti-electromagnetic interference (EMC) ability, meeting the electromagnetic environment requirements of industrial sites.
Power supply characteristics: The working voltage is DC 24V (±10%), with power consumption of approximately 15 to 25W. It supports reverse connection protection and overvoltage protection.
Application scenarios
It is applicable to process control in fields such as power generation (such as DCS systems), petrochemicals, metallurgy, and municipal engineering, and can be used as a core controller to achieve real-time monitoring and regulation of equipment such as boilers, steam turbines, and reactors.
